Cubita NOW - News from Cuba

Cubita NOW - News from Cuba

Nieuws en tijdschriften 28.20M by Cubita NOW v4.1 4.3 Feb 27,2023

Cubita NOW - News from Cuba free download

Free Download If the download doesn't start,Click Here